Kristian007 10 Geschrieben 17. November 2006 Melden Geschrieben 17. November 2006 Hallo an alle, ich bräuchte mal wieder die Hilfe von einem Scriptguru. Ich möchte gerne in einer bestimmten OU div.Domain Lokale Gruppen erstellen. Wäre toll wenn ich dem Script den Namen über eine txt mitgeben könnte. Dann wäre es mir möglich mehr als eine Gruppen anlegen zu lassen oder das ich immer wieder das Script anpassen muss. Ich danke euch im voraus und wünsche allen die diesen Beitrag lesen ein schönes Wochenende.;)
woiza 10 Geschrieben 17. November 2006 Melden Geschrieben 17. November 2006 Hi, schau mal, ob du hiermit weiterkommst. Gruß woiza
Kristian007 10 Geschrieben 17. November 2006 Autor Melden Geschrieben 17. November 2006 Hi Woiza, das Script habe ich mir bereits geholt und entsprechend angepasst, aber irgendwie bleibt er bei dem objgrup.put hängen. Const ADS_GROUP_TYPE_LOCAL_GROUP = &h4 Const ADS_GROUP_TYPE_SECURITY_ENABLED = &h80000000 Dim objFSO, objInputFile, strOU, objRootOU, objNewOU 'Hier anpassen Const filePath = "C:\TEMP\Scripte\ou.txt" Const strStartOU = "ou=Fileservice,dc=blg,dc=local" 'Hier nicht ;-) Const forReading = 1 'File öffnen Set objFSO = CreateObject("Scripting.FileSystemObject") Set objInputFile = objFSO.OpenTextFile (filePath, ForReading) 'StartOU holen Set objRootOU = GetObject("LDAP://" & strStartOU) 'Loop über alle Zeilen des File Do Until objInputFile.AtEndOfStream strOU = objInputFile.ReadLine Set objNewOU = objGroup.Put("sAMAccountName", "strOU") objGroup.Put "groupType", ADS_GROUP_TYPE_LOCAL_GROUP Or _ ADS_GROUP_TYPE_SECURITY_ENABLED objGroup.SetInfo Loop objInputFile.Close
woiza 10 Geschrieben 17. November 2006 Melden Geschrieben 17. November 2006 Hi, du machst ein Set objRootOU = GetObject("LDAP://" & strStartOU), um die OU zu holen, versuchst aber die OU in einer Set objNewOU = objGroup.Put("sAMAccountName", "strOU") zu erstellen. Gruß woiza
Empfohlene Beiträge
Erstelle ein Benutzerkonto oder melde dich an, um zu kommentieren
Du musst ein Benutzerkonto haben, um einen Kommentar verfassen zu können
Benutzerkonto erstellen
Neues Benutzerkonto für unsere Community erstellen. Es ist einfach!
Neues Benutzerkonto erstellenAnmelden
Du hast bereits ein Benutzerkonto? Melde dich hier an.
Jetzt anmelden